Differences Between Available Trailer Hitches for 2020 Chevy Blazer

Question:
What's the diff between the Curt and Drawtite hitches for 2020 Chevrolet Blazer? Not sure which to get.
asked by: Rodrigo P
Expert Reply:
The major differences between the Curt # C13418 and the Draw-Tite # 76023 are the hitch capacity, the way they install and the difficulty of the installation.
The Curt hitch has a 5000 lb towing/750 lb tongue weight capacity, while the Draw-Tite has a slightly lower capacity at 4500 lb towing/675 lb tongue weight.
Both hitches install so that the receiver extends through the removable panel in the bumper, but the Curt installs from underneath, and will take about 40 minutes for a professional installer, while the Draw-Tite would require that the bumper cover and bumper beam be temporarily removed, and would take a pro about 2 hours to install.
I'd recommend the Curt # C13418 due to its slightly higher capacity and much easier installation.
If you'll be towing with the hitch, you'll need a trailer wiring harness like # 118720 for a 4 pole or # 118276 for a 7-way. For a ball mount, use # 2753 and # 19260 for a 1-7/8 inch or # 63845 for a 2 inch trailer ball.
